Canvas Apps in the Publisher
Canvas enables you to expose your canvas apps as quick actions. The publisher allows users access to the most common actions in your organization. You can expand the publisher to include a canvas app so that users can leverage the common custom actions of a canvas app. These actions can then integrate with the feed and create a feed post specific to the action that was performed.
- Add content from a Web application into the Chatter publisher.
- Create a custom action that exposes a canvas app.
- Integrate your canvas app directly into the publisher life cycle: post from your canvas app into the Chatter feed, use the Share button functionality, and designate where to post your message.
For example, you might have a canvas app that your users use to log their hours worked. You can create a quick action that allows a user to open that canvas app in the publisher so they can quickly submit a time record, all right from within the publisher.
Users can still access the canvas app in the standard way for full functionality; but the canvas app in the publisher provides quick access to the most common functions of your app. A user can select the quick action and create a Chatter feed item that can be a text post, a link post, or even a canvas post.
